## Account Recovery — Tarniva Pricing Experiment

If the experiment dashboard locks you out mid-rollout (happens more than we'd like), don't panic. The ticket-pricing variants for the Glimmerfare A/B test keep running server-side, so no customer impact. First, try the normal reset flow through the Opaline console. If that bounces you back to the login loop, use the break-glass recovery account instead — it bypasses the flaky SSO hop entirely. You'll be prompted for the recovery passphrase, which is noted directly below this paragraph.

unlock words, tawif-tahop: oliys-ulawyn-tamdor-lamys-casox-jormir-fraius-kasath-ulador-ulamir-holir-sorys-holeth

Internal Memo — Customer Concentration Risk

To the board: Thornvale Systems now derives 46% of revenue from a single account, Kestrane Utilities. Contract renewal falls in eleven months. Mitigation underway: two mid-market pursuits and a channel pilot in the Averly region. Quarterly exposure reporting begins immediately. The confidential business-plan note follows below.

management briefing: Project Ulavan slips by two quarters because of the staffing delay.

**Runbook: Build Agent Clock Skew (Harborline CI)**

Symptom: jobs on the Marrowgate agent pool fail signature validation with "timestamp outside window." Cause: agents drift after resuming from hibernation; the Tockward sync daemon sometimes stalls. Fix: restart `tockwardd` on the affected agent, confirm offset is under 2 seconds with `tockctl status`, then requeue the failed jobs. If more than three agents are skewed, force a pool-wide resync via the Harborline admin endpoint, authenticating with the key below.

gateway credential: kto3_qfe